Kitchen Island Installation in Bloomington, IN
Kitchen island installation services involve adding or upgrading a central workspace feature within a kitchen, often serving as a focal point for cooking, dining, and socializing. These projects can include installing new islands, replacing existing ones, or customizing designs to match the layout and style of the space. Property owners typically seek this service to enhance functionality, increase storage, or improve the overall aesthetic of their kitchen area.
Homeowners interested in kitchen island installation should consider factors such as available space, desired features, and the type of materials used. Understanding the scope of the project, including any necessary modifications to plumbing, electrical wiring, or cabinetry, can help ensure a smooth process. Clarifying preferences for size, design, and functionality beforehand can lead to a more satisfying outcome tailored to the specific needs of the household.

Kitchen Island Installation Questions
What types of kitchen islands can be installed? Various options include standard, custom, portable, and multi-level islands tailored to different kitchen layouts and needs.
Is it possible to add a kitchen island to an existing space? Yes, existing kitchens can often accommodate new islands with proper measurements and site preparation.
What materials are commonly used for kitchen islands? Common materials include wood, quartz, granite, and laminate, chosen for durability and style preferences.
What should property owners consider before installing a kitchen island? Consider available space, functionality needs, plumbing or electrical requirements, and overall kitchen design compatibility.
